Scott County, MN Hispanic or Latino Population By Origin in 2021 (ACS-5Yrs)

Updated on March 3, 2025.

Based on the US Census ACS-5Yrs estimates, in 2021, among the 8.16K Scott County, MN hispanic or latino population, 4.87K had Mexican origin (59.66%), 1.13K had Central American origin (13.90%), and 682 had Puerto Rican origin (8.36%).

Scott County, MN Hispanic or Latino Population By Origin in 2021

Hispanic Origin Population Percent of Hisp. Pop. (%)
Mexican 4867 59.66
Central American 1134 13.90
Puerto Rican 682 8.36
South American 581 7.12
Salvadoran 532 6.52
Guatemalan 372 4.56
All Other Hispanic 356 4.36
Spaniard 247 3.03
Peruvian 236 2.89
Ecuadorian 122 1.50
Spanish 114 1.40
Dominican 107 1.31
Venezuelan 104 1.27
Panamanian 97 1.19
Honduran 91 1.12
Cuban 70 0.86
Colombian 56 0.69
Nicaraguan 42 0.52
Chilean 29 0.36
Argentinean 24 0.29
Bolivian 7 0.09
Other South American 3 0.04
